Benefits of Cumin Water

  • Aids Digestion: Cumin is known for its ability to stimulate the secretion of digestive enzymes, which can help speed up digestion. If you frequently experience bloating, indigestion, or other stomach discomforts, a glass of cumin water can provide quick relief.
  • Boosts metabolism: Cumin water helps the body break down fats more efficiently. Many people include cumin water in their morning routine to kickstart the day with a metabolism boost.
  • Detoxifies the Body: The antioxidants found in cumin help flush out toxins from the body, supporting overall detoxification. Drinking cumin water regularly can keep your liver and kidneys healthy.
  • Improves Skin Health: Cumin is rich in Vitamin E, which helps keep the skin healthy and glowing. It also has ant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ties, which can help reduce acne and blemishes when consumed regularly. Drinking cumin water can support clearer, more radiant skin from the inside out.
  • Boosts Immunity: Packed with antioxidants and essential vitamins, cumin water helps strengthen the immune system. Regular consumption can help your body fend off common illnesses and infections, keeping you healthier overall.
  • Prevents Iron Deficiency: Cumin seeds are a rich source of iron, making cumin water an excellent natural remedy for anemia or anyone looking to increase their iron intake.

How to Make Cumin Water

There are two simple methods to prepare cumin water, depending on your preference:

Soaked Cumin Water:
• Take 1-2 teaspoons of cumin seeds and soak them in a glass of water overnight.
• In the morning, strain the water and drink it on an empty stomach. The seeds release their beneficial nutrients into the water as they soak, making this a mild yet effective method.

Boiled Cumin Water:
• Take 1-2 teaspoons of cumin seeds and add them to 2 cups of water.
• Boil the water for 5-10 minutes until the water reduces to about one cup.
• Strain the seeds and let the water cool slightly before drinking. This method extracts more nutrients and provides a stronger flavor.
